Shinigami

Also known as Gods of Death, they are beings who live in their own world, the world of death, a lifeless and depressing place, and they use notebooks (Death Notes) to prolong their lives by murdering humans.

Normal humans are unable to perceive the presence of a shinigami, to see them, and to touch them.

Shinigami have their characteristic red eyes, called Shinigami Eyes, which allow them to see a person's life expectancy and name.

They cannot die like a normal person, since due to their nature, however they are able to prolong their life by writing the name and visualizing the face of the human they wish to kill... once done the human dies in 40 seconds of a heart attack if the reason was not specified and the Shinigami obtains the life time that the person he killed had left.

Death Note

At first glance, the Death Note looks like a normal notebook, with a black color and the name "Death Note" on the cover of the book; however, it is the main tool used by the shinigami.

If a normal human touches the Death Note, they will immediately see the Shinigami who owns the notebook; however, a person can touch several notebooks and see the owners of those notebooks at the same time.

Unlike shinigami, humans do not gain the life expectancy of the people they kill with the notebook, nor can they see the names or life expectancy of the people they kill... this is only possible if the human makes a deal with the shinigami, obtaining the Shinigami eyes, which allows them to see the life expectancy of people and their names... however, they will not be able to see their own data or that of other Death Note holders and will shorten the life expectancy of the person by half.

It is said that if someone uses the Death Note, they lose the right to go to heaven, although in the anime there is never any mention of a "paradise," an omnipresent god, or angels.

The pages of the notebook can be torn out to later write the names of his victims on it, making the murders easier and ensuring that it is more difficult for someone to accidentally touch the notebook and be able to see the Shinigami.

Rules of the Death Note

  1. Rule of name and face For the Death Note to work, you must write the person's name while picturing their face. This prevents confusion between people with the same name.

  2. Rule of death by default If no cause of death is specified, the person will die of a heart attack after 40 seconds.

  3. Rule of specifying the cause You can determine the cause of death within the first 40 seconds after typing the name.

  4. Rule of the details of death After writing the cause, you have an additional 6 minutes and 40 seconds to specify the details of the death.

  5. Rule of stock control You can control the person's actions before their death, as long as they are physically possible and consistent with the situation.

  6. Rule of limitations If the conditions for death are not possible, the person will simply die of a heart attack.

  7. Rule of humans The Death Note only affects humans; it cannot kill shinigami or other beings.

  8. Shinigami Visibility Rule The human who touches the notebook will be able to see and hear the shinigami who owns that Death Note.

  9. Ownership Rule The person who possesses the Death Note becomes its owner until they lose it or give it away.

  10. Rule of memory loss If the owner loses possession of the Death Note, they will also lose all memories related to it.

  11. Rule of the eye exchange A human can make a deal with a shinigami to obtain the "shinigami eyes," which allow them to see the name and lifespan of other people in exchange for half of their own life.

  12. Handling Limit Rule You cannot make one person kill another using the Death Note; if you try, the victim will die of a heart attack.

  13. Maximum control time rule You can only control the person before their death for a limited time (up to 23 days in the future).
